New York: Touchstone, 1965. First edition. Hardcover. Orig. black cloth decorated in gilt with paper spine label. Fine in original glassine. Friedlaender, Johnny. 80 pages. 32 x 24 cm. Ninety plates -- black and white and tipped-in color plates with an original color lithograph by Friedlaender laid-in. Introduction by Max-Pol Fouchet. Text in French, English and German. Lovely, fresh copy.
